  1. Medium is an American online publishing platform developed by Evan Williams and launched in August 2012. It is owned by A Medium Corporation. The platform is an example of social journalism, having a hybrid collection of amateur and professional people and publications, or exclusive blogs or publishers on Medium, and is regularly regarded as a blog host.

  4. Evan Clark Williams, born on March 31, 1972, in Clarks, Nebraska, is an American entrepreneur, businessperson, and computer scientist. He is the founder of multiple companies and services, such as Medium, Blogger, and Twitter, as well as a former CEO of Twitter. Williams received his education from the University of Nebraska–Lincoln.
